SFTP Public-Key Authentication (id_ed25519)

See more SFTP Examples

Demonstrates how to authenticate with an SSH/SFTP server using publickey authentication with an Ed25519 private key (id_ed25519).

require 'chilkat'

success = false

# This example assumes the Chilkat API to have been previously unlocked.
# See Global Unlock Sample for sample code.

key = Chilkat::CkSshKey.new()

# The id_ed25519 file should contain something like this:
# (You can open it in a text editor..)

# -----BEGIN OPENSSH PRIVATE KEY-----
# b3BlbnNzaC1rZXktdjEAAAAACmFlczI1Ni1jdHIAAAAGYmNyeXB0AAAAGAAAABDIeK9+Xw
# 6Do9gnhtrJu5iJAAAAZAAAAAEAAAAzAAAAC3NzaC1lZDI1NTE5AAAAIMh/Ge7fjQCssmVd
# BqjYZbRAI0pY8IrnB6J1yLetq34OAAAAoMVP7cvy4hTiAINA3I4v55OonkpKza8mzfUW18
# RDQeYL3ovCVaAYOGcCpf/SW3QiY6tnXq+5WDEfJ7Z/kQ0nl2+1wSLOytxpyO+IY0rRtLrX
# 6e/agR4nbZpt/MFG6xqcNASbtDgg+9IWGvDrtXOLFofx07/zml+UjFL0tXRpCjOxeqKyXH
# t8SRgdT97d9/bYPwapaXY+b2DVVy5/LVx4Sq8=
# -----END OPENSSH PRIVATE KEY-----

privKeyText = key.loadText("c:/temp/id_ed25519")
if (key.get_LastMethodSuccess() != true)
    print key.lastErrorText() + "\n";
    exit
end

# If your private key was saved encrypted, then you'll need the password.
# In this example, the password "blahblah" is valid for the above key -- which is a real Ed25519 key generated/saved from puttygen.
key.put_Password("blahblah")

success = key.FromOpenSshPrivateKey(privKeyText)
if (success != true)
    print key.lastErrorText() + "\n";
    exit
end

sftp = Chilkat::CkSFtp.new()

# Set some timeouts, in milliseconds:
sftp.put_ConnectTimeoutMs(5000)
sftp.put_IdleTimeoutMs(15000)

hostname = "sftp.example.com"
port = 22
success = sftp.Connect(hostname,port)
if (success != true)
    print sftp.lastErrorText() + "\n";
    exit
end

# Authenticate with the SSH server.  Chilkat SFTP supports
# both password-based authenication as well as public-key
# authentication.  
success = sftp.AuthenticatePk("myLogin",key)
if (success != true)
    print sftp.lastErrorText() + "\n";
    exit
end

print sftp.lastErrorText() + "\n";
print "Public-Key Authentication Successful!" + "\n";

# Now go do whatever you're app needs to do...
